Jane McDonald officially opens new MRI suite at Pinderfields' Hospital
The TV star and singer officially cut the ribbon earlier today
A new MRI suite which will play a 'vital role' in cutting waiting times for patients at Pinderfields' Hospital has been officially opened by TV personality Jane McDonald.
The Wakefield raised singer has been a big backer of the fundraising campaign to get the facility open.
An appeal was launched to install state of the art new equipment at the Wakefield site back in 2022, with Jane matching the money raised by the trust's radiology team.
Keith Ramsay, Chairman of Mid Yorkshire Teaching NHS Trust, said: “This £6 million development, funded through a combination of Trust budget allocations, a grant from NHS England, and the MY MRI Appeal, led by MY Hospitals Charity, will significantly increase our MRI capacity."
"It includes a dedicated recovery area, enabling us to offer MRI scans under general anaesthetic for children, so families no longer need to travel to Leeds or Sheffield for these vital scans."
